Volvo - corporate safety campaign

Volvo, in keeping up with the brand heritage did an initiative to educate consumers (drivers and non drivers alike) on the safety aspects when driving a car.

Some of the alarming facts we found when doing this project was that people are blatantly ignoring the basic safety aspects when they get into a car.

Like how pregnant women did not wear their safety belts in fear that they might injure the baby.

(The irony).

Or how kids were made to wear safety belts designed for adults.

Or improper baby seat application.

Hence the campaign.





(Pregnant lady headline reads : Some simple pointers on protecting your unborn children in cars)
